What is CMYK & Pantone?

  • Printers implement CMYK (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, Black) as their subtractive color model for producing printed materials. Different percentages of CMYK ink colors applied, one on top of another enable producers to generate multiple color combinations. CMYK serves as the best color format when producing complete-color printed materials, including brochures, magazines and packaging.
  • PMS serves as the proprietary color system that functions in printing together with manufacturing operations. Precise color consistency depends on Pantone since it supplies pre-mixed standardized ink colors rather than requiring color mixing like CMYK. Uniformity between multiple printing methods and materials becomes possible through the application of Pantone in branding activities and product designs, as well as corporate identity development.

Why do I need to convert CMYK to Pantone?

CMYK colors can vary across different printers and materials, making it difficult to achieve consistent branding. Pantone provides standardized colors that ensure uniformity across all mediums.

What does the 'Distance' setting do?

You can adjust the distance setting to determine the color-matching scope from narrow to broad. The precision of color matches depends on the selected value since lower numbers result in precise matches but higher values present diverse Pantone alternatives.
